Did you know that right now we are looking at any injury in the secondary other than bench corner (Devon Torrence) will mean the starter will be no better than our third team guy, who would be backed up by a player who was going to redshirt, or a walk-on. If Hines goes down at the Star we are looking at Nate Oliver or a walk-on as the starter because it looks like now that Christian Bryant is out for the year. You can't win a national championship with this current line-up on defense. We saw our free safety get eaten alive by Minnesota, the worst team in the Big Ten right now.
